Patient Zharkova Vokogon V.A., Russian, 12 years old (checked by metric statement), a student of the school at the Commune. Lenin was discovered by accident in the clinic, where she came for a certificate. On August 23, she was admitted to the city hospital for a more detailed examination. On admission, she complained of general weakness, dizziness and mild headaches.
